Solution

The correct option is D Both Assertion and Reason are incorrect

Assertion and reason both are wrong. Because in Mendeleev's periodic law, properties of elements are the periodic function of their atomic mass and Mendeleev's periodic law could not explain the phenomenon of anomalous pairs.
